Stopping the “Had To”

What a week! I felt drained and exhausted. All week I was attending to those things that I “had to” do. By the time Friday came, it was a real struggle to keep going. My work was not complete. Saturday rolled on. Another morning meeting that I “had to” attend. Then the afternoon finalizing essential writings that “had to” be submitted that day.

There was nothing left.

I finally stopped and reviewed the week, “Why was I so exhausted?” I couldn’t comprehend. I didn’t feel that I had achieved much. The writing, the projects that I wanted to do, weren’t touched. These are the things that fill my soul with joy, yet, I hadn’t found time for them. The “had to” took priority.

In the moments of reflection, I remembered. I had spent the week doing the things that I am not designed to do. These are the things that I need to be hand to someone else to do.

My friend and mentor, Heather Joy Bassett, constantly reminds me that I need only to do the things that bring me joy. The work that is set out for me in my life keep me going. These are the things that inspire me, and when I focus on them, I inspire others. Only then can I be an Authentic Influence.

There are many different tools available to help us understand what we are designed to do. Tools that unlock the secret of who you are and guide you on the journey. However, take a moment to connect with the soul of who you are. What is it in your work life that brings you the most joy? When you’re feeling low, what is it that will get you out of bed and have you in the excitement zone, with “I don’t want to miss this!”

Each of us has something different that we are designed to do. Take some time to connect with this. Hand over the “had to” to someone else and focus on the “want to.” This is where you will have your Ultimate Impact on the world.
